What Can I Bring With Me to The Treatment Center?

Rehab should be a time that allows you to start creating healthy habits away from drugs and alcohol. If you are going for inpatient treatment in Williamstown, it is important that you find out about the things that you may be allowed to bring with you. Most of these programs will allow you to come with: A journal, A list of the all medications that you are taking, An alarm clock,Athletic outfits, Calling card, Clothes,Debit or credit card, Hygiene and beauty products that do not contain alcohol, Identification documents, Laundry detergent, Pictures of loved ones, Shoes,Small bills, Stationary, and Toiletries.

Does The Rehab Offer an Aftercare Program?

Aftercare is an important component of long term recovery. For this reason, you should not ignore it when you start looking for a professional drug rehab and treatment program. If you find it difficult to get a job, connect with the local community, or locate essential resources, there is a high risk that you could relapse.

For this reason, you should only enroll in drug rehab programs in Williamstown that offer aftercare services. Alternatively, find a program that can connect you with the resources that could help you once you check out of the treatment program.

Do They Provide Support Groups for When I Complete My Treatment?

It might be in your best interests to find out if the drug rehab you are considering in Williamstown offers support group meetings. This is because various research studies have shown that these meetings can be effective in reducing the risk of relapse as well as in leading to better outcomes in long term recovery.

To this end, you may want to check into a treatment program that offers support groups. If they do not provide this service, they should at least be able to recommend or refer you to some support groups that can help you continue keeping up with the lessons you learned while you were receiving treatment for your addiction.
